Amazon says Jeff Bezos will step down as CEO and transition to the role of Executive Chair in Q3; AWS CEO Andy Jassy will become the CEO of Amazon at that time — Amazon announced on Tuesday that AWS CEO Andy Jassy will replace Jeff Bezos as CEO during the third quarter of this year.| Amazon Investor Relations: |

Spotify reports Q4 results: 345M MAUs, up 27% YoY, as paying subscribers grew to 155M, up 24% YoY, topping expectations; revenue was up 17% YoY to €2.17B — But streaming giant offers conservative outlook for the current year as new sign-ups could ebb| Ron Amadeo / Ars Technica: |

Sony says it shipped 4.5M PlayStation 5 units worldwide in 2020, and reports revenue of $8.4B in Q3, up 40% YoY, operating profit of $763.3M, up 50% — A similar figure to the PS4 launch — Sony shipped 4.5 million PlayStation 5 units worldwide in 2020, as revealed by information published alongside … | Jay Greene / Washington Post: |
